General:

 

1.

 

Always keep your feet on the scooter. 

2.

 

Do not exceed the weight capacity of 400lbs. 

3.

 

Do not attempt to lift or move the scooter by any of its removable parts. 

Personal injury and damage to the scooter may result. 

4.

 

Never try to use your scooter beyond its limitations as described in the 

manual. 

5.

 

Do not operate your scooter if it is not functioning properly. 

6.

 

Do not connect any electrical or mechanical device to the scooter. Failure 

to obey this instruction may result in injury and will void the warranty. 

7.

 

Always comply with local laws and regulations. 

Use While Under the Influence of Medication or Alcohol:

 

1.

 

Check with you physician if you are taking any medication that may affect 

your ability to operate your scooter safely. 

2.

 

Do not operate your scooter while you are under the influence of alcohol 

as this may impair your ability to operate your scooter in a safe manner.
